PEG Ratio is defined as the PE Ratio without NRI divided by the growth ratio. The growth rate we use is the 5-Year EBITDA growth rate. As of today, TP ICAP GROUP's PE Ratio without NRI is 10.53. TP ICAP GROUP's 5-Year EBITDA growth rate is 8.40%. Therefore, TP ICAP GROUP's PEG Ratio for today is 1.25.

* The 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ate is the 5-year average EBITDA per share growth rate. While the denominator is a percentage, we use the whole number as opposed to the decimal form for the calculation. For example, 5% would be shown as 5 as opposed to 0.05. If it's smaller than or equal to 0, then the PEG Ratio is not calculated.

TP ICAP GROUP  (OTCPK:TCAPF) PEG Ratio Explanation

To compare stocks with different growth rates, Peter Lynch invented a ratio called PEG Ratio. PEG Ratio is defined as the P/E ratio divided by the growth ratio. He thinks a company with a P/E ratio equal to its growth rate is fairly valued. Still he said he would rather buy a company growing 20% a year with a P/E of 20, instead of a company growing 10% a year with a P/E of 10.

TP ICAP GROUP Business Description

Other Exchanges TCAPl:UKTCAP:UK8D7:Germany
Address 135 Bishopsgate, London, GBR, EC2M 3TP
TP ICAP GROUP PLC provides broking professional intermediary services to match buyers and sellers of different financial, energy, and commodities products. Its role includes creating liquidity and price discovery in markets and providing insight and context to the clients. The company provides proprietary over-the-counter ('OTC') pricing information in the world with the data on financial, energy, and commodities products. Its clients include banks, insurance companies, pension funds, asset managers, hedge funds, central banks, energy producers and refiners, risk and compliance managers, and charities. The company's segments include Global Broking which generates key revenue, Energy & Commodities, Liquidnet, Parameta Solutions, and Corporate.
